Simplifying Health Care Administration And Cost For Employers
There was a time when most critical health care decisions took
place within the confines of the doctor-patient relationship. But
that was then and this is now. And now, while it’s still about the
delivery of quality health care to patients, it’s also about how
employers manage the processes, the structures and the costs of
their overall health care program. It’s about how claims are
settled and managed, safety programs administered and monitored,
and financial plans rated and evaluated. These pieces are integral
in fighting the rising costs of healthcare – and minimizing their
impact on the bottom line.
For employers of all types, how these interrelated pieces of
the overall health care program are selected and managed can make
or break both the quality of employee care and the cost at which
it is offered. And, after its selection, the management and
administration of the health care program benefits become pivotal
in its success.

Our approach is personalized, knowledgeable and responsive. We
employ a three-pronged service approach that includes:
- Accident and Loss Prevention which includes periodic
safety inspections; OSHA record keeping consultation, regulation
compliance, and citation defense; and ergonomic assessment and
remediation.
- Financial Oversight including underwriting or manual
classification review; group rating analysis; retrospective
rating evaluation; self insurance studies; and business
planning.
- Claims Management including evaluation of ongoing
claims from previous experience periods; assistance in the new
claim certification decision process; active involvement with
both the employer and the health care provider to accomplish
early return to work of injured workers; assistance obtaining
appropriate medical care for injured workers; implementation of
independent medical exams and other cost control measures where
appropriate; and assistance in early prevention of costly and
time consuming litigation.
